Background
Patella, Lawrence M. was born on August 10, 1929 in Danbury, Connecticut, United States. Son of Frank Peter and Benevanuti (Negri) Patella.

Associate of Arts, Mesa College, San Diego, 1976.
Enlisted, United States Navy, 1947; commissioned ensign, United States Navy, 1958; advanced through grades to commander, United States Navy commanding officer, United States Ship Jennings County, 1965-1967; assistant force operations officer, Amphibious Force Pacific Fleet, 1967-1970; commander, United States Ship Wood County, 1970-1972; director ship to shore department, United States Naval Amphibious School, Little Creek, Virginia, 1972-1974; Executive officer, United States Ship Duluth, 1974-1976; commanding officer, United States Ship Mount Vernon, 1976-1978; manager navigation division, Port of Portland, Oregon, since 1978; executive director, Western Dredging Association, Vancouver, Washington, since 1992.
Member Retired Officers Association (Columbia River chapter president 1990-1993), Navy League (president 1995-1996), Pearl Harbor Survivors Association (associate).
Married Nancy Blackford, December 13, 1953 (deceased). Children: Richard, Terri Patella McHenry, DEbra Patella Holton, Susan Patella Planz, Michael. Married Nancy Lee Blakey, April 22, 1978.
